mpthecat 928 Posted June 12, 2020 Share Posted June 12, 2020 “Between mid-2017 and early 2020, amid song leaks and demos slipped into cosmetics commercials ("The Haus Labs mix of 'Babylon' will be released, so don't stress," BloodPop promises) the pair expanded their scope by bringing in a crew of accomplished producers, songwriters, and internationally renowned artists — including Ariana Grande, BLACKPINK, and Elton John — to help shape their vision for a progressive dance album. Some of Gaga's collaborators — BloodPop, BURNS, Johannes Klahr, Axwell, and more — spoke to EW about how it all came together.”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...

POPARTHD 7,053 Posted June 12, 2020 Author Share Posted June 12, 2020 Axwell also contributed an unfinished song he'd been toying with for six years. The bare-bones track, which would become "Sine From Above," had originally been written for Elton John with Ryan Tedder and Axwell's creative partner, Sebastian Ingrosso, back in 2014.
